George Legeza
Reviewed in the United States on April 17, 2020
Coming up with a review for this lamp was... not easy.On the one hand, it's really a cheap piece of junk. If you're the kind of person who thinks that all Ikea furniture is flimsy garbage, then just run far, far away. The construction of this lamp/shelf is worse in every way than the cheapest stuff you'll find there. I'm the kind of person who thinks that well-assembled flatpack furniture ranges from fine to great, and I still find the materials used in this lamp to be unacceptably cheap. The veneer is inconsistent and scratches off easily, the engineered wood is shockingly flimsy, and the whole thing is too light to offer any kind of stability. The shade also absorbs a huge amount of light, so it's pretty dim, too.On the other hand, you won't find this style of lamp much cheaper anywhere else, and the slightly pricier versions at big-box retailers have the exact same quality issues. It also looks good... from a distancee. If you want something that can act as a display case while providing a bit of light, then this is a cheap and good option. If you need more light, then a bulb Y-splitter will increase the light level from "poor" to "acceptable." Assembly is also very easy and the instructions are clear. The cheap materials do mean that you need to be careful during while building it since it's not hard to scratch the veneer or even damage the poles.Would I recommend it? Sure, with caveats. I wouldn't use it as a nightstand or end table where you'll routinely be messing with stuff on the shelves. It's just too flimsy and it really does feel like you'll knock it over if you touch it. If you're going to put it on carpet, then get some spikes or something. In general, I would strongly recommend placing something heavy on the bottom shelf for stability. I've got a decorative wood box on the second shelf and I think the box is heavier than the entire lamp. I'd also recommend using smart bulbs just because I don't trust the pull chain to last.All that said, it's a nice display piece and it does look really, really good as long as you don't inspect it too closely. It provides nice mood lighting for a room, and with a bulb splitter it can be a decent primary light for a small-ish space. It's also not any cheaper or crappier than the very, very similar lamps that cost twice as much. If you know what you're buying and you're okay with the flaws, then it's good for the price.
